Output 6aa051f0f69d6fafb50ceeea435fc58520cab2e1390f4231a2f22ebf88ea4086:0

value
17905100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689e7e338f8ea64a98696dbc659f37103bf3cb75 OP_EQUAL
address
3BEC4n8uB6QZjQwEoHoFByBEQhdHqCuS8s
transaction
6aa051f0f69d6fafb50ceeea435fc58520cab2e1390f4231a2f22ebf88ea4086
spent
true